Shipping Logistics for South Korea Shoppers

Before you hit the checkout button on the Rhode website, it is essential to understand the logistics of moving small cosmetic items across the Pacific. Since these are lightweight products, the efficiency of your parcel forwarding service becomes the deciding factor in your total savings.

Shipping Estimates for Rhode Products

Metric Estimation
Box Weight Approx. 0.5 lbs (0.23 kg) for a 3-pack of tints.
Box Dimensions Small (Approx. 6 x 4 x 2 inches).
Volumetric Warning Low risk. Lip tints are dense and small; you will likely be charged by actual weight rather than size.
Battery Check None. These items contain no lithium batteries and face fewer shipping restrictions.

To get a precise idea of the total cost including international postage, you can use the shipping calculator to compare different speed options. Generally, smaller items are perfect for consolidation if you plan on buying other US-exclusive goods at the same time.

The ₩45,000 Price Gap Explained

Let’s look at the math. In February 2026, a single Rhode Peptide Lip Tint retails for approximately $16 USD (roughly ₩21,000) on the official US website. In contrast, local resellers on South Korean marketplaces often list the exact same new shades for upwards of ₩66,000. When you factor in a reasonable international shipping fee of ₩15,000 to ₩20,000, you are still looking at a significant difference.

By choosing to shop US store directly, you can save ₩45,000 or more, especially when purchasing multiple shades or the full 2026 collection. This price gap is the primary reason why savvy shoppers prefer using a package forwarding solution. Import Duties and Taxes for South Korea

When shipping to South Korea, it is vital to stay within the de minimis value to avoid extra costs. For most consumer goods arriving from the US, the duty-free limit is $200 USD. However, for cosmetics and many other categories, the threshold is often lower at $150 USD if the items are categorized as "list-clearance" goods.

Exceeding this amount will trigger import tax and potentially a 10% VAT. To keep your Rhode haul economical, try to keep the total value of your shipment (including US domestic shipping) under the $150 mark.
